Ordinals
alpha
Sat 797866451541232
decimal
159573.1451541232
degree
0°159573′309″1451541232‴
percentile
37.9936405913755%
name
ieulaibawbh
cycle
0
epoch
0
period
79
block
159573
offset
1451541232
timestamp
2011-12-28 18:20:38 UTC
rarity
common
prev
next